<< Please advise-I was told to search for a file that was a virus and sure
enough I had the file in question.  But I'm afraid it might be a valid file
and the warning  is a hoax.  The file is  JDBGMGR.exe and has a teddy bear I
was supposed to NOT click.  Just delete.  Is this a vaild file or should I
delete it?  Thanks and ASAP!
  >>

According to Symantec's site, that is a hoax.
